Factors Affecting Cost
- Driveway Size: Larger driveways require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Material Quality: Higher quality blacktop materials are more expensive but offer better durability and appearance.
- Labor Rates: Labor costs can vary based on the contractor's experience and the complexity of the project.
- Site Preparation: Costs can increase if extensive grading, excavation, or drainage work is needed.
- Permits and Inspections: Obtaining necessary permits and passing inspections can add to the total expense.
- Weather Conditions: Houston's climate can impact the scheduling and duration of the project, potentially affecting costs.
- Additional Features: Extras like decorative edges, seal coating, or specialized finishes can increase the price.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task Description | Average Cost Range (Houston, TX) |
---|---|
Basic Blacktop Installation | $3,000 - $6,000 |
High-Quality Blacktop Installation | $5,000 - $9,000 |
Site Preparation and Grading |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Seal Coating | $300 - $600 |
Decorative Edges | $500 - $1,000 |
Drainage Installation | $1,000 - $2,500 |
Permits and Inspections | $100 - $500 |
